    The large numerical aperture and high resolution mobile phone lens using the plastic asphere lenses E48R and LEXANH is demanded with the development of mobile phone market. A kind of large numerical aperture and high resolution mobile phone lens was designed by using Code-v optical design software. The mobile phone lens is constituted by five plastic asphere lenses, an infrared cut filter, and a sensor cover glass. The first and fourth lenses are positive lenses. The second, third, and fifth lenses are negative lenses. Design results show that when the space frequency is 350lp/mm, the modulation transfer function (MTF) of all field of view are more than 0.2, and the MTF of 0.7 field of view are more than 0.34. The field curves are less than 0.02mm, and the distortion are less than 2.55%. It provides a reference value for similar systems.
